Human infection studies: Key considerations for challenge agent development and production.
Shobana Balasingam1, Sarah Meillon1, Cecilia Chui2
1Infectious Diseases | Prevention, Wellcome Trust, UK, London, N1 2BE, UK.
Developing safe human infection (or challenge) studies requires careful selection and production of challenge agents. This work outlines essential considerations for producing high-quality agents outside of Good Manufacturing Practice (GMP) facilities.

Background:
- Human infection studies are crucial for developing new vaccines and therapeutics.
- The selection and production of challenge agents are critical steps in these studies.
- Current regulatory oversight for challenge agent manufacturing varies globally.
Discussion:
- Manufacturing challenge agents in Good Manufacturing Practice (GMP) facilities ensures quality and safety.
- However, GMP production is not always feasible, especially when intermediate vectors are required.
- There is a need for clear guidance on minimum requirements for safe challenge agent production outside GMP.
Key Insights:
- This document addresses the lack of clear guidance for producing safe challenge agents outside GMP.
- It details a framework for selecting and producing challenge agents to ensure quality and minimize volunteer risk.
- The considerations aim to standardize safe practices in challenge agent development.
Outlook:
- This framework will aid researchers in developing robust protocols for challenge studies.
- It supports the advancement of vaccine and therapeutic development through safer human infection models.
- Future work may involve refining these guidelines based on practical application and emerging technologies.
